General Description / Primary Purpose
The Student Financial Aid Specialist, under the direction of an Assistant Director or above, assists in the design, development and implementation of departmental processes and/or programs. Recommends policies and procedures to ensure effective coordination of departmental programs.
Essential Duties
Job Function
This position reports to the Assistant Director of Student Financial Aid, and is responsible for auditing, evaluating and monitoring students’ financial aid records to determine eligibility for awarding financial aid programs. Interprets rules and regulations governing all state and federal financial aid programs as established by audit reports, regulatory changes in Title IV programs and Federal Registers in coordination with the Director of Student Financial Aid. Evaluates Satisfactory Academic Progress appeals as needed. Prepares reports and responds to surveys.

Job Function
Provides support to the Director of Student Financial Aid in managing all Financial Aid processes and workflows in coordination with the Student Financial Aid Tech Support Specialist. Coordinates all Banner jobs for the Financial Aid module. Runs many Banner jobs for the Financial Aid module, including the downloading of ISIRS from federal processing, the disbursing of federal aid, the requesting of outstanding requirements and notification of students regarding their financial aid. Coordinates testing of all Banner upgrades, patches and new aid year set up for Financial Aid programs with the Student Financial Aid Tech Support Specialist. Monitors and assists with all technological set up and processing involving all federal, state and institutional programs and refunds/repayment calculation and processing for all Title IV and state programs. Plans, designs, develops and assists with the implementation of various technological/web-based tools and services which will support both the internal technology functions of the Financial Aid team with the Processing Office, as well as the external flow of information to students about their Financial Aid awards. Works with Assistant Director of Student Financial Aid, Student Financial Aid Tech Support Specialist and Information Technology to plan, develop and implement technological strategies for streamlining all Financial Aid functions. Resolves Financial Aid workflow issues, and for designing technological enhancements and development to workflows that will allow for effective and efficient management of the student financial aid programs in coordination with Enrollment Services Systems and ITS.

Statement(s) of Understanding Definition
This position requires a background check. In conjunction with the University’s policy, this position may also require a credit check.
This position has been designated as a Campus Security Authority (CSA). This position has been designated as a CSA because it involves significant responsibility for student and campus activities and/or responsibility for campus security. As such, any person in this position must report to the University Police Department a crime or an incident that might be a crime that he/she becomes aware of. This position has a reporting requirement because the University believes that responsibility for students, campus activities and/or campus security will make the holder of this position someone members of the University community will see as an authority figure and someone to whom they can seek help. A CSA is not expected to investigate or determine whether a criminal incident actually took place. A CSA’s responsibility is a duty to report. All positions designated as CSAs are required to complete an online or in-person training session. For more information concerning the training sessions or CSAs, please contact the University Police Department at (904) 620-2800 or the Office of the General Counsel at (904) 620-2828.
The holder of this position is designated as a “Responsible Employee” pursuant to their role under Title IX. Therefore, the incumbent must promptly report allegations of sexual misconduct, sexual violence, and child sexual abuse by or against any student, employee, contractor, or visitor to the University’s Title IX Administrator or any divisional Title IX Coordinator.
